A SAP Case Study
SEW-EURODRIVE, a global industrial manufacturing company, needed to modernize its warehouse operations by moving a highly customized SAP Extended Warehouse Management environment from SAP Business Suite to SAP S/4HANA without disrupting day-to-day business. The company also faced a tight timeline to support the go-live of a new warehouse, so it needed expert help to complete the migration on schedule.
SAP provided SAP Services and Support, SAP S/4HANA, SAP EWM, the SAP S/4HANA migration cockpit, and SAP MaxAttention to guide the migration, testing, data transformation, and go-live support. As a result, SEW-EURODRIVE transformed warehouse logistics and operational processes, completed the move on time and under budget, and achieved a smooth implementation with no business interruption, while building the know-how to handle future warehouse rollouts more independently.
